Phoenix Court is conveniently located with easy access to university campuses and everyday city amenities. Cabot Circus is just across the road, offering a wide range of shops, restaurants and a cinema, while nearby Castle Park is ideal for jogging, relaxing or having a picnic with flatmates during warmer months. The University of the West of England can be reached in around 25 minutes by public transport, and the nearest bus stop is approximately 9 minutes away on foot. Within a short walk, students can also reach cafés, international restaurants, Bristol Shopping Quarter, St Nicholas Market and Tesco, making daily life highly convenient.
The accommodation offers 277 student bed spaces, with every room including a private bathroom. Residents benefit from a range of communal facilities designed for relaxation, study and social life. Phoenix Court has two communal lounges, one on the ground floor and one in the basement, with additional shared facilities available at the neighbouring Marketgate residence. These spaces include pool tables and table tennis, while Marketgate also provides table football and two study rooms. The building also offers Wi-Fi, electronic key card access, on-site security, CCTV coverage, a 24/7 service hotline, property services, maintenance support, fire alarm systems, accessible facilities, lift access, bicycle storage, vending machines, printing facilities, laundry facilities, study areas and free social events.
